We are seeking an experienced QA Engineer to join our team in the Kingdom of Saudi Arabia (KSA). The ideal candidate will have strong experience in quality assurance within large-scale building (üst yapı) projects, regardless of engineering discipline. This role focuses on process quality, compliance, documentation, and continuous improvement, ensuring that all project phases meet contractual, regulatory, and international quality standards.

Responsibilities
Quality Assurance & Compliance
  • Develop, implement, and maintain QA procedures in alignment with project specifications and international standards.
  • Ensure all construction processes (design, procurement, installation, finishing, commissioning) comply with approved project quality plans.
  • Conduct internal audits, process reviews, and compliance checks to ensure adherence to QA requirements.
  • Identify potential risks and implement preventive measures to avoid nonconformities before they occur.
Process Management & Coordination
  • Review and verify documents such as:
  • Method statements
  • Material submittals
  • Quality plans (PQP)
  • Work procedures
  • Subcontractor QA documentation
  • Ensure smooth coordination between engineering, procurement, and construction teams regarding quality requirements.
  • Support cross-disciplinary teams (civil, architectural, MEP) on QA-related matters.
Documentation & Reporting
  • Prepare and manage QA documentation, including audit reports, compliance records, corrective/preventive action plans (CAPA), and checklists.
  • Maintain complete traceability of QA documents for internal, client, and consultant reviews.
  • Submit timely quality performance reports and KPI updates to project management.
Continuous Improvement & Training
  • Analyze recurring quality issues and propose systemic improvements to enhance overall project performance.
  • Promote a strong quality culture across the project team through coaching, training sessions, and QA awareness activities.
  • Ensure lessons learned are collected, documented, and integrated into future project stages.
Stakeholder Coordination
  • Collaborate with clients, consultants, and subcontractors regarding QA requirements and audit findings.
  • Participate in meetings and coordinate quality-related actions to ensure full compliance and alignment among project stakeholders.
